I have been living in the Seattle area for little over a year and a half. For those who like Authentic Mexican food, here is my list of recommended places (from a true Mexicano):

  • El Fogon is probably the best all-around Mexican place. Not a fancy restaurant but with very good food. Located about 5 minutes west of the SeaTac airport. Worth the drive
  • La Carta de Oaxaca is a nice place, located in Ballard, with Mexican cuisine from the state of Oaxaca. HIghly recommended. Make sure to go early or make a reservation, especially on weekends
  • Taqueria El Gallo is what we call an Antojeria: a fast-food place where you can get sopes, tostadas, enchiladas, pozole and more. Good for lunch, and it is located in downtown Redmond. (across from Jerzy's Coffee which is highly recommended)
  • Oobas is also located in downtown Redmond, and while less authentic it has good food too.
  • La Barriga Llena is a Torteria in federal Way which I haven't been to but heard is also worth the drive
  • Guerrero's is not a restaurant but a Mexican store where you can buy sweet bread (I am additec to Conchas), all kinds of grocieries such as good refried beans, tortillas, and Carnitas on weekends.
